WebEc·ba·ta·na (ĕk-băt′n-ə) A city of ancient Media on the site of present-day Hamadan in western Iran. It was captured by Cyrus the Great in 549 bc and plundered by Alexander, Seleucus I, and Antiochus III. American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, Fifth Edition.
